so im getting ready to sell my car and i m doing a little touching up...new tires, carpet, and paint. I was wondering has anybody dealt with Maaco yet? Ive heard theyre crap and do cheap work. if somebody has had them paint a car, how much was it? and was it good. thanks

i just had my truck painted their a few weeks ago. make DAMN sure u go over the car after they paint it cz there were a few little runs on some parts but they fixed it for free no questions asked tho so that was good. other than that it looks pretty good but i mean its not THE best but i dont regret it. and they didnt do a very good taping things off like the door handles and trim around the windows and got overspray on them but i needed to repaint them anyway and was planning on it after i got the truck back. its worth the money if ur on a budget.

Im not sure how to put this, but yes they do crap work. But they also do good work too. You get what you pay for. The $300 paint job Im talking about is where they dont tape off window/door seals, trim. They just paint right over it. But Ive also seen some decent paint jobs from them too. Teddy, a guy in town I know has a older (box style) caprice with 22s. Maaco painted his ride a pearl white with a electric blue flake. The paint job really sparkles and shines. I think he said it costed $1600 (which is still cheaper then a bodyshop) even tho its still not the quality of a higher priced paint shop, Id still roll with teddys paint job on my ride. :)
